Is Hi-Class Pizzeria & Restaurant clean?

Hi-Class Pizzeria & Restaurant is currently Grade A from NYC Department of Health and Mental Hygiene (DOHMH), from an inspection on February 12, 2025. Inspectors wrote up 1 critical violation β€” the kind most directly linked to foodborne illness. On Cooked's ladder that reads clean πŸ˜‡.

How New York grades restaurants

New York City health inspectors score violations in points, and lower is better: 0–13 points earns an A, 14–27 a B, and 28 or more a C. Every restaurant is inspected at least once a year, and the letter has to be posted in the window. A restaurant that scores 14 or more on the first inspection of a cycle does not get a letter right away β€” it stays β€œGrade Pending” until a re-inspection settles it, which is why some spots here show an hourglass instead of a letter.
